电脑驱动分类

电脑驱动程序(驱动程序)是操作系统与硬件设备之间的桥梁,用于使操作系统能够识别并与硬件设备进行通信。以下是常见的驱动分类:

1. 设备驱动程序

  • 显示驱动程序 :控制显卡和显示器的显示功能,负责图形渲染和屏幕显示。
    • 示例:NVIDIA、AMD 显示驱动程序。
  • 打印机驱动程序 :允许操作系统与打印机通信,控制打印任务。
    • 示例:HP、Canon 打印机驱动程序。
  • 声卡驱动程序 :管理音频输入和输出,与声卡硬件交互。
    • 示例:Realtek、Creative 声卡驱动程序。
  • 网络驱动程序 :负责网络接口卡(NIC)的功能,管理网络连接和数据传输。
    • 示例:Intel、Broadcom 网络驱动程序。
  • 存储驱动程序 :控制硬盘、固态硬盘(SSD)和其他存储设备,管理数据读写。
    • 示例:SATA、NVMe 驱动程序。

2. 系统驱动程序

  • 操作系统核心驱动程序 :内核模式驱动程序,直接与操作系统内核交互,管理硬件和系统资源。
    • 示例:文件系统驱动程序、虚拟内存驱动程序。
  • 虚拟设备驱动程序 :用于虚拟化环境中,创建虚拟设备或管理虚拟化资源。
    • 示例:虚拟机监控程序(如 VMware Tools)。

3. 应用程序驱动程序

  • 应用程序接口驱动程序 :提供特定应用程序所需的接口或功能,如某些软件特定的硬件控制。
    • 示例:专业图形软件的定制显卡驱动程序。

4. 外部设备驱动程序

  • USB 驱动程序 :管理 USB 设备的连接和通信,包括各种外部硬件,如鼠标、键盘、外接存储设备。
    • 示例:USB 控制器驱动程序。
  • 蓝牙驱动程序 :处理蓝牙设备的连接和数据交换。
    • 示例:蓝牙适配器驱动程序。

5. 特殊功能驱动程序

  • 安全驱动程序 :用于管理安全硬件,如加密卡、身份验证设备。
    • 示例:硬件加密模块(HSM)驱动程序。
  • 电源管理驱动程序 :管理设备的电源状态和节能功能。
    • 示例:电池管理驱动程序。

驱动程序的正确安装和更新对于系统的稳定性和性能至关重要。不同的硬件设备需要不同的驱动程序,操作系统通过驱动程序实现对硬件的支持和控制。

相关推荐
Digitally2 天前
如何在电脑上轻松访问 iPhone 文件
ios·电脑·iphone
AidLux2 天前
在不同型号的手机或平板上后台运行Aidlux
智能手机·电脑·aidlux
电手2 天前
Win10停更,Win11不好用?现在Mac电脑比Win11电脑更便宜
windows·macos·电脑·mac
浅水鲤鱼2 天前
笔记本电脑开机无线网卡自动禁用问题
电脑
Digitally2 天前
如何轻松将视频从安卓设备传输到电脑?
android·电脑·音视频
Rverdoser3 天前
电脑频繁黑屏怎么办
电脑
EstrangedZ3 天前
使用Virtual Serial Port Driver+com2tcp(tcp2com)进行两台电脑的串口通讯
电脑
hgdlip3 天前
电脑为什么换个ip就上不了网了
网络·tcp/ip·电脑
搬码临时工3 天前
公网ip怎么申请和使用?本地只有内网IP如何提供外网访问?
运维·服务器·网络·tcp/ip·电脑·远程工作
开开心心就好3 天前
高效视频倍速播放插件推荐
python·学习·游戏·pdf·计算机外设·电脑·音视频